Default Excel in Office 2000 Premium

I have Office 2000 Premium on my PC.
When I go to open any Exel spreadsheet it opens them all with Interenet
Explorer not with the software from the Office Premium suite.
How do I get the spreadsheets open with the correct software?

I'd try re-registering excel:

Close Excel and
Windows Start Button|Run
excel /regserver

The /regserver stuff resets some of the windows registry to excel's factory
defaults.
